Definition

Compromised Asset is any information asset that were compromised during a Cyber Incident.

“Compromised” refers to any loss of confidentiality/possession, integrity/authenticity, availability/utility (primary security attributes). Naturally, an incident can involve multiple assets and affect multiple attributes of those assets.
